Application
Carbon fiber custom hoods are primarily used as a high-performance accessory for vehicles. They enhance the aesthetic appeal of cars while improving their aerodynamics and overall performance. However, carbon fiber has many other applications beyond automotive use.
In the sports industry, carbon fiber is commonly used to manufacture bicycles, golf clubs, tennis rackets, and other equipment to improve their performance and reduce weight. It is also used in the medical field due to its excellent biocompatibility and non-toxicity, making it an ideal material for manufacturing medical devices.
Carbon fiber reinforced thermoplastic composites (CRTP) have gained widespread attention in industries such as aerospace, rail transportation, defense, and wind power generation due to their numerous advantages. Carbon fiber is primarily used as a reinforcing material for resin materials, resulting in carbon fiber-reinforced resins (CFRP) with excellent comprehensive properties. These materials are widely used in missiles, space platforms, launch vehicles, aircraft, advanced ships, rail vehicles, electric vehicles, trucks, wind turbine blades, fuel cells, power cables, pressure vessels, and other fields.
Overall, carbon fiber is a high-performance and high-tech material with a wide range of applications and great development potential.


Advantages
Lightweight:
Carbon fiber is significantly lighter than traditional materials like1. Lightweight: Carbon fiber is significantly lighter than traditional materials like steel or aluminum, which can improve the overall performance and handling of a vehicle.
Strength:
Despite its lightweight nature, carbon fiber is incredibly strong and durable, making it an ideal material for use in high-performance applications such as custom hoods.
Aesthetic appeal:
Carbon fiber has a unique, sleek appearance that many car enthusiasts find visually appealing. Custom carbon fiber hoods can enhance the look of a vehicle and make it stand out on the road.


Thermal properties:
Carbon fiber has excellent thermal conductivity, which means it can help dissipate heat from the engine and prevent overheating. This can improve the longevity of the engine and other components.
Customization:
Carbon fiber is highly customizable, allowing for a wide range of design options and finishes. This makes it possible to create a truly unique and personalized look for a vehicle.
Durability:
Carbon fiber is resistant to corrosion and rust, which means custom carbon fiber hoods can last longer than traditional materials and require less maintenance over time.
Performance benefits:
By reducing weight and improving aerodynamics, custom carbon fiber hoods can improve the overall performance of a vehicle, including acceleration, braking, and fuel efficiency.
